Understanding the Adolescent Journey

In today’s fast-paced, complex world, teens face more pressures and uncertainties than ever before.


The adolescent years are a critical stage of development — marked by rapid physical growth, emotional shifts, and evolving social dynamics. These changes can make them more vulnerable to stress, anxiety, depression, and other mental health challenges.

Prioritizing the mental health of our youth means recognizing early signs of struggle and addressing them with care and understanding.
Through timely support and guidance, teens can learn healthy coping skills, build confidence, and develop the resilience they need to navigate life’s challenges.

Common Stressors Impacting Teen & Young Adult Mental Health

Teens and young adults today face a unique set of pressures that can significantly affect their emotional well-being. These challenges often overlap, creating a cycle of stress that can feel overwhelming without the right support. Common Stressors Include:

Academic pressure – High expectations and constant performance demands

Social pressures – Navigating friendships, peer influence, and fitting in

Bullying – Both in-person and online harassment

Family issues – Conflict, lack of communication, or strained relationships

Overexposure to social media – Unrealistic comparisons, cyberbullying, and information overload

​Poor sleep habits – Irregular schedules and insufficient rest affecting mood and focus

Poor eating habits or eating issues – Unhealthy patterns that can harm both physical and emotional health

Body image concerns – Negative self-perception impacting self-esteem and confidence

Self-harm – As a coping mechanism for intense emotions

Neglect – Emotional or physical needs going unmet

Abandonment issues – Feelings of rejection or loss

Anxiety and depression – Persistent worry, sadness, or hopelessness

Instability or chaos – Unpredictable home or life circumstances

Why Early Intervention Matters

Prevents small issues from growing into larger mental health challenges

Builds lifelong skills for handling stress, relationships, and self-esteem

Improves communication between teens and their parents

Helps create a sense of safety, stability, and hope
